RSM McGladrey Energy Survey
The 2008 RSM McGladrey Manufacturing and Wholesale Distribution Survey highlighted inflation in energy, raw materials and transportation costs as a key concern for mid-sized companies. During discussions of the survey findings with legislative leaders in Washington, we were asked to update our results from April 2008. The responses were surprising. When 357 of the same executives surveyed for our April report were asked about these costs, they were far more pessimistic about inflation. Compared to the April findings:
- 50% more companies anticipate energy costs to rise by more than 10%
- 60% more companies expect raw materials costs to rise by more than 10%
- 160% more companies expect transportation costs to rise by more than 10%
"Increased global competition for raw materials and energy mean that companies will need to take immediate action and adopt new long-term strategies," says Tom Murphy, RSM McGladrey Executive Vice President of Manufacturing and Wholesale Distribution.
